Division Propagation
Step-by-step guide to division π±
Timing is crucial when propagating Goeppertia roseopicta. The best period for division is during the growing season, specifically from spring to early summer.
To get started, gather your tools: a clean, sharp knife or garden spade, and a clean pot with drainage holes.
The Process
Begin by carefully removing the plant from its pot.
Next, gently separate the root ball into sections, ensuring that each division has roots and at least one stem.
Finally, replant each division in its own pot filled with fresh, well-draining soil.
Best practices for successful division πΏ
After planting, water the divisions thoroughly to help them settle in.
It's essential to keep the newly divided plants in a warm, humid environment to encourage recovery.
Monitor your plants for signs of stress, such as wilting or yellowing leaves, and adjust your care as needed.

Stem Cutting Propagation
π± How to Take Stem Cuttings
To start propagating Goeppertia roseopicta through stem cuttings, first select healthy stems. Aim for those that are at least 4-6 inches long and have several leaves.
Next, use a clean, sharp knife or scissors to cut just below a node. This is crucial for encouraging root growth. After cutting, remove the lower leaves to prevent rot when you place the cuttings in soil or water.
π§ Rooting Stem Cuttings in Water vs. Soil
Water Propagation:
- Place your cuttings in a glass of water, ensuring the node is submerged.
- Change the water every few days to prevent stagnation.
- Typically, roots will develop in about 2-4 weeks.
Soil Propagation:
- Optionally, dip the cut end in rooting hormone to boost growth.
- Plant the cutting in a pot filled with well-draining soil.
- Water lightly and cover the pot with a plastic bag to maintain humidity until roots develop.
Both methods are effective, but your choice may depend on your available resources and personal preference.

Environmental Conditions for Propagation
π§οΈ Ideal humidity and temperature
Creating the right environment is crucial for successful propagation of Goeppertia roseopicta. Aim to maintain humidity levels above 60% to encourage optimal rooting.
The ideal temperature range for propagation is between 70Β°F to 80Β°F (21Β°C to 27Β°C). This warm environment helps stimulate growth and supports the overall health of your cuttings.
π‘ Light requirements during propagation
Light plays a vital role in the propagation process. Provide bright, indirect light to prevent leaf burn while promoting healthy growth.
Avoid direct sunlight, as it can dry out cuttings and increase stress. Instead, find a spot where your plants can bask in gentle light, ensuring they thrive as they establish their roots.

Common Challenges and Solutions
π οΈ Troubleshooting propagation failures
Propagation can sometimes feel like a game of chance, but knowing the signs of failure can help you turn things around. Look out for wilting, yellowing leaves, or a lack of root developmentβthese are clear indicators that something isn't right.
To address these issues, start by ensuring that humidity levels are adequate. Go ahead and check for root rot by examining the base of your cuttings; if you see mushy roots, it's time to take action. Adjust your watering practices to find the sweet spot between over and under-watering.
β Avoiding common mistakes in propagation
Even seasoned plant parents can stumble into common pitfalls during propagation. One major mistake is using soil that retains too much moisture, which can lead to rot and ruin your efforts.
Another frequent error is not providing enough humidity or light. To set yourself up for success, always use clean tools to prevent disease transmission. Regularly monitor your cuttings for signs of stress, and be ready to adjust your care routine as needed.
